Hello everyone
I am new to Airbnb and have a question about cleaning fees please.
At the moment I am charging a cleaning fee for stays of less than 5 nights. I have set this in House Rules and in the listing. My question is - how do I get payment for the cleaning fee as it's separate to the Airbnb fee?
Any tips would be appreciated thanks.
Rochelle
Answered! Go to Top Answer
@Chris-and-Rochelle0 The cleaning fee is automatically added to ANY booking no matter the length of stay. If you want to waive the fee for longer stays, you would use the refund option on the reservation. Hope this helps. 😄
It seems like you're trying to do something quite complicated and convoluted to apply.
Indeed, why post a cleaning fee and then 'waive' it for a particular length of stay?
You can't assume inquirers will figure it out, let alone bother reading your House Rules prior to booking.
I would rather advise to either apply it to all days of a booking or none.
If the latter, you can calculate a daily rate and cost it into your rental price.
According to some Hosts there is a benefit in not applying a cleaning fee, in that your listing will appear higher up in the ranking. (I recall one post on this subject. Check 'Search' on the Community Centre with keyword 'cleaning fees'.)

You as a host decides what the cleaning fee should be. I rent out a room and my cleaning fee is about 10 dollars/booking.
You can edit all the different prices like fee for extra people, cleaning fee under booking settings - >price settings.
